Our Ethos

At Park Nursery, we firmly uphold a set of core values and beliefs that shape our approach to childcare and early education. Our mission is straightforward yet profoundly important – to provide every child in our care with a foundation of love, compassion, and kindness that will serve as the bedrock for their future. Our aim is to provide children with tools to manage and thrive in school and then the wider community. To that end, we strongly promote the development of self-esteem, resilience, independence and social skills.

As a not-for-profit organisation, we reinvest every penny we receive to enhance our facilities and improve the lives of our children.

Educational Philosophy:

We believe in child-led learning. Our philosophy revolves around supporting the individual needs of each child, ensuring they develop at their own pace while building self-confidence, resilience, and emotional well-being. Our goal is for every child to step into the world with confidence, ready to embrace the journey of learning and self-discovery.

Safety and Wellbeing

The safety and wellbeing of our children are our top priorities. Each member of our dedicated staff holds a clear and valid DBS, Paediatric First Aid, and Safeguarding Children qualifications. We have taken every measure to create a secure and nurturing environment where children can explore, learn, and grow. Our Designated Safeguarding Lead is Rachael Bridges.

  • Our nursery is located within a beautiful Victorian school building, where natural light floods through big windows, creating a bright and inviting atmosphere. We have ample room for play and exploration, both indoors and in our secure outdoor area. Our environment is designed to provide sensory stimulation, encouraging children to learn through their senses and curiosity.

  • We understand the importance of involving parents in the nurturing process. We work closely with parents to provide the best possible care for their children, including offering appropriate foods and consistency according to the stage of weaning, or introducing hand-held foods to aid in the development of baby-led weaning.

  • At Park Nursery we firmly believe in equality and inclusivity. We welcome and embrace every child who enters our doors, valuing the diversity of our nursery community.

Quality of Care:

To ensure that every child receives the attention and care they deserve, we assign a designated key worker to each child. These key workers are responsible for completing observations and summary sheets per the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S), ensuring that each child's unique developmental journey is documented and supported.
